Tannins are polyphenol compounds that are The natural way developing in apples. Depending on the variety of cider apple the producer is applying, the tannin amounts are going to be distinct. The greater properly-recognised ciders typically have reduced tannin degrees although common ciders have more. One particular example of a common tannin existing in cider is Procyanidin B2.[46]

Yeast varieties like Brettanomyces bruxellensis and Brettanomyces lambicus are widespread in lambics. On top of that, other organisms for example Lactobacillus micro organism make acids which add to your sourness.[107]

Boiling also destroys any remaining enzymes left over in the mashing stage. Hops are included in the course of boiling to be a supply of bitterness, flavour, and aroma. Hops could possibly be extra at multiple position throughout the boil. The extended the hops are boiled, the greater bitterness they lead, but the significantly less hop flavour and aroma keep on being within the beer.[53]

The normal Asturian sidra is actually a still cider of 4–eight% power, although you will discover other varieties. Ordinarily, it's served in sidrerías and chigres, pubs specialising in cider where by It is additionally feasible to produce other drinks and also regular foodstuff. Probably the most outstanding properties is that it is poured in quite compact quantities from a top into a broad glass, with the arm holding the bottle extended ciders upwards along with the a person holding the glass prolonged downward.

Lately, a fresh sort called ice cider has long been marketed. This type of cider is created from apples with a very substantial degree of sugar because of pure frost.
